alecpl
2011-09-23 9e54e6fd455326185b54b5e2cb1b7936c7817670
program/steps/addressbook/export.inc
@@ -66,14 +66,14 @@
}
// send downlaod headers
send_nocacheing_headers();
header('Content-Type: text/x-vcard; charset='.RCMAIL_CHARSET);
header('Content-Disposition: attachment; filename="rcube_contacts.vcf"');
while ($result && ($row = $result->next())) {
    // we already have a vcard record
    if ($row['vcard'] && $row['name']) {
        echo rcube_vcard::rfc2425_fold($row['vcard']) . "\n";
        $row['vcard'] = preg_replace('/\r?\n/', rcube_vcard::$eol, $row['vcard']);
        echo rcube_vcard::rfc2425_fold($row['vcard']) . rcube_vcard::$eol;
    }
    // copy values into vcard object
    else {
@@ -90,7 +90,7 @@
            }
        }
        echo $vcard->export(true) . "\n";
        echo $vcard->export(true) . rcube_vcard::$eol;
    }
}